“If a shoe had been designed from a woman’s foot, would I be running without getting the injuries?”: running footwear needs and preferences of recreational and competitive women runners across the lifespan

Abstract

Despite known sex and gender differences between males/men and females/women, most current running footwear is designed for and tested on males/men. This qualitative study aimed to explore the running footwear needs and preferences of recreational and competitive women runners and how these change across the lifespan. We conducted two semi-structured focus groups with women runners in Vancouver, Canada. Participants were purposively sampled for variation in age, running experience and running volume. Data analysis used an inductive reflective thematic approach. Twenty-one women runners (11 recreational, 10 competitive) of median (IQR) age 43 (20–70) years and median (IQR) running experience of 15 (6–58) years participated. Nine (43%) women had experience running during pregnancy or postpartum. Three main themes emerged regarding women’s running shoe needs and preferences: prioritising comfort and feel; the perceived contribution of the shoes to injury prevention; and the need for different shoes for different running contexts. Additionally, three main themes described how runners’ needs evolve across the lifespan: a shift from prioritising shoe style to comfort; increased shoe size and width during pregnancy/postpartum; and a growing preference for greater shoe stability and cushioning with age. Our results suggest that current running footwear does not fully meet the needs of women runners. Many women desired a wider toe box, a narrower heel cup and more cushioning, while competitive runners sought performance-enhancing features that did not compromise comfort. Women also strongly believed that footwear plays a critical role in injury prevention, highlighting the need for evidence-based education on this topic. These insights provide a foundation for the co-design of women-specific running shoes that better align with their unique biomechanical and performance needs. Future research should investigate whether sex-, gender- and life stage-specific shoe designs could enhance running performance, comfort and injury prevention for women across all levels of participation.
